I didn’t experience ‘juju’ during my time in Kumawood – Mavis Adjei

Kumawood actress Mavis Adjei has responded to claims made by her fellow actress, Portia Asare, about the decline of the Kumawood film industry.

In a July 2024 interview, Asare attributed the industry’s troubles to factors like ‘juju’ (black magic) and jealousy.

Speaking to ZionFelix, Adjei reminisced about her time in Kumawood, noting that the environment was once filled with camaraderie and goodwill.

“I was there with Portia Asare, and we used to joke together as colleagues, and the same thing with Nana Ama McBrown. It was all love then,” she recalled.

She mentioned working alongside Asare and Nana Ama McBrown, highlighting the positive relationships they shared.

Adjei also acknowledged that, since she is no longer actively involved in the industry, she cannot fully contest Asare’s views.

“Portia is still there and she knows what she’s talking about. She has experienced all that. So I can’t disagree with her,” Adjei stated.
